About Birgit Federmann

Birgit Federmann is a scholar working on Pathology and Forensic Medicine, Hematology, Oncology, Genetics and Immunology, having authored 47 papers that have together received 855 indexed citations. Recurring topics across this work include Lymphoma Diagnosis and Treatment (18 papers), Hematopoietic Stem Cell Transplantation (13 papers), Acute Myeloid Leukemia Research (11 papers), Chronic Lymphocytic Leukemia Research (10 papers), CAR-T cell therapy research (7 papers), Immune Cell Function and Interaction (5 papers), Acute Lymphoblastic Leukemia research (5 papers) and Viral-associated cancers and disorders (4 papers). The work is most often cited by research in Hematology (339 citations), Genetics (183 citations), Pathology and Forensic Medicine (290 citations), Immunology (266 citations) and Oncology (258 citations). Birgit Federmann has collaborated with scholars based in Germany, United States and Spain. Frequent co-authors include Falko Fend, Wolfgang Bethge, Leticia Quintanilla‐Martínez, Lothar Kanz, Irina Bonzheim, J Schmidt, Wichard Vogel, Rupert Handgretinger, Julia Steinhilber and C. Faul. Their work appears in journals such as Blood, Annals of Hematology, Archiv für Pathologische Anatomie und Physiologie und für Klinische Medicin, Haematologica and Bone Marrow Transplantation.
